Pistachio nuts unsalted
CARBS
8 grams
PROTEINS
6 grams
FATS
13 grams
Quantity: 28 grams (about 49 kernels)
Glycemic Index: 15
Glycemic Load: 2
Fiber: 3 grams
Key Nutrients: Vitamin B6, potassium, antioxidants
Health Impact: The low carbohydrate content and presence of healthy fats and proteins in pistachios help in moderating blood sugar levels and reducing insulin spikes.

🥄 Smart Substitutes
- Almonds – Similar in fat content but higher in Vitamin E, which is beneficial for skin health.
- Walnuts –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which can help reduce inflammation and improve heart health.
- Macadamia nuts – Lower in carbs and higher in monounsaturated fats, supporting heart health.
⏱ Blood Sugar Timeline
- 0–15 min: No significant impact on blood sugar due to low carbohydrate content.
- 30–60 min: Minimal impact on blood sugar, as the fat content slows the absorption of any carbs.
- 2–3 hr: Stable blood sugar levels due to high fat and moderate protein content, with very low carbs.

🤔 FAQs about Pistachio nuts unsalted
How many pistachios can I eat without affecting my blood sugar?
Portion control is key; typically, a serving size of about 28 grams (roughly 49 nuts) is considered safe for most people with diabetes.
Are pistachios a good snack for diabetes?
Yes, due to their low carbohydrate content and healthy fats, pistachios are an excellent snack for managing blood sugar levels.
